Bicyclo(3.1.0)hexan-3-ol, 4-methylene-1-(1-methylethyl)-, acetate, (1alpha,3beta,5alpha)-

Taxonomy Lipids and lipid-like molecules > Prenol lipids > Monoterpenoids > Bicyclic monoterpenoids
IUPAC Name [(1S,3R,5S)-4-methylidene-1-propan-2-yl-3-bicyclo[3.1.0]hexanyl] acetate
SMILES (Canonical) CC(C)C12CC1C(=C)C(C2)OC(=O)C
SMILES (Isomeric) CC(C)[C@@]12C[C@@H]1C(=C)[C@@H](C2)OC(=O)C
InChI InChI=1S/C12H18O2/c1-7(2)12-5-10(12)8(3)11(6-12)14-9(4)13/h7,10-11H,3,5-6H2,1-2,4H3/t10-,11-,12+/m1/s1
InChI Key PBWRFXQNNGSAQG-UTUOFQBUSA-N

Physical and Chemical Properties

Top
Molecular Formula C12H18O2
Molecular Weight 194.27 g/mol
Exact Mass 194.130679813 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 26.30 Ų
XlogP 2.40
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 2.54
H-Bond Acceptor 2
H-Bond Donor 0
Rotatable Bonds 2
